With its Regional Innovation Strategy<br />

2<strong>01</strong>4 – 2020 (RIS), Saxony-Anhalt is<br />

setting its future path and establishing<br />

itself as an innovative location<br />

for research, development and business in Europe.<br />

One of its key components is the leading market<br />

of energy, mechanical and plant engineering, and<br />

resource efficiency.<br />

According to the RIS, intelligent, integrated and<br />

sustainable economic regions should develop in<br />

Europe. What is the goal of the RIS in Saxony-<br />

Anhalt?<br />

DORRIT KOEBCKE-FRIEDRICH: The economy is set<br />

to change even more rapidly in the future. We need<br />

to support our businesses by placing an ever greater<br />

focus on innovation and sustainability. In this<br />

respect, Saxony-Anhalt has defined five markets of<br />

the future which arise from our economic structure.<br />

One is the market of energy, mechanical and<br />

plant engineering, and resource efficiency.<br />

Why do energy efficiency and mechanical and<br />

plant engineering go together?<br />

ANDREA VOSS: On the one hand, mechanical and<br />

plant engineering firms such as Enercon are providing<br />

energy production technology. On the other hand,<br />

the customers of the mechanical engineering firms<br />

are also demanding energy efficient products. Also,<br />

the actual energy consumption of the manufacturing<br />

businesses themselves is naturally of considerable<br />

importance. Therefore, it makes sense to bring<br />

these areas of expertise together. They are further<br />

supple mented by the loop economy and resource<br />

efficiency.<br />

ANDREA VOSS<br />

Senior Manager, Investment<br />

and Marketing Corporation<br />

Saxony-Anhalt (IMG)<br />

DORRIT KOEBCKE-FRIEDRICH<br />

Senior Manager, Investment<br />

and Marketing Corpo ration<br />

Saxony-Anhalt (IMG)<br />

Where do the strengths of Saxony-Anhalt lie?<br />

DORRIT KOEBCKE-FRIEDRICH: Here in Saxony-<br />

Anhalt, we produce more energy than we use. Our<br />

local businesses sell excellent products that they<br />

make with the use of innovative technology. Research<br />

institutes in the areas of energy, automation, material<br />

economics and the loop economy provide the<br />

possibility of entrepreneurial innovations.<br />

What role does IMG play in the implementation of<br />

the regional innovation strategy?<br />

ANDREA VOSS: The Investment and Marketing<br />

Corporation Saxony-Anhalt (IMG) is the pilot, as it<br />

were, which guides the businesses that come to<br />

Saxony-Anhalt. We provide advice on site selection<br />

and the networking between the partners.<br />

partners. Our service relates to the creation of jobs<br />

and the settlement of industrial companies, which<br />

strengthen the value added chain in the federal<br />

state. IMG helps to forge networks between the<br />

businesses and the research institute in the federal<br />

state, for example.<br />

DORRIT KOEBCKE-FRIEDRICH: New ideas from the<br />

areas of research and development in the federal<br />

state also support the approach of attracting<br />

global companies to Saxony Anhalt, such as US<br />

Engineering AG of Switzerland. And we are also<br />

supporting com panies from Saxony-Anhalt, such<br />

as AV-TEST and Gollmann Kommissioniersysteme<br />

(order picking sys tems), with their plans for growth<br />

and internationalisation.<br />

Laempe & Mössner are world market leaders in the<br />

production of core shop technologies. The focus<br />

lies also on the networking and intelligent control<br />

throughout the core shop.<br />

Andreas Mössner is a hands-on businessman. Everything<br />

seems to say it. His neat suit, his confident handshake, his<br />

clearly arranged office. An app tells him how much extra<br />

time he's gained since stopping smoking and cutting out<br />

cigarette breaks. Time to live? More like time to work! As<br />

the Managing Director of Laempe & Mössner GmbH, the<br />

35-year-old’s schedule is pretty much full: his company sells<br />

its products on five continents – and is expanding.<br />

THE MECHANICAL AND PLANT<br />

ENGINEERING COMPANY IS THE<br />

WORLD MARKET LEADER in the<br />

production of core shop technology<br />

for foundries. In this respect,<br />

the company has become a popular<br />

partner to the automotive industry,<br />

to rail carriage construction,<br />

and to manufacturers of ship<br />

engines, pumps and fittings. “For<br />

our customers, we construct<br />

machinery that makes cores,”<br />

explains Mössner. These cores,<br />

which consist of a hardened sand<br />

mixture, function as place-holders<br />

for the subsequent cavities in the<br />

casting moulds. “The cores disappear<br />

after the casting, leaving<br />

sophisticated internal geometries<br />

behind.” Cylinder heads, engine<br />

and hydraulic units are just some<br />

examples of the cast parts of this<br />

kind.<br />

THE RANGE OF PRODUCTS OF-<br />

FERED BY LAEMPE & MÖSSNER<br />

also includes – addition to the<br />

core shooting – gassing units<br />

which support the hardening of<br />

the cores. The offering is rounded<br />

off with sand mixers, sand preparation<br />

systems and robot-supported<br />

after-treatment solutions<br />

for cores, for the de-bur ring of<br />

the cores, for example. “And we<br />

also oversee the networking<br />

and intelligent management of<br />

the entire core shop,” explains<br />

Mössner. The company stands for<br />

complete solutions: its employees<br />

not only make and deliver the<br />

machines, they also install them<br />

at the customer’s premises, service<br />

them and manufacture spare<br />

parts. “Our strength is our support,<br />

which is valued highly all over the<br />

world,” says Mössner decisively.<br />

Mössner views internationalisation<br />

to be the key success factor. The<br />

company has employees in offices<br />

all over the world as well as a network<br />

of 25 sales and service partners.<br />

Mössner explains that he favours<br />

local partners, particularly in places<br />

where the local culture differs<br />

markedly from the European<br />

approach. “Take the plain speaking<br />

that everyone here in Germany<br />

likes. People in Asia can find that<br />

really off-putting.” Mössner, who<br />

studied industrial engineering,<br />

previously lived in China for a<br />

while with his wife, where he<br />

developed a sales office. “Our<br />

entire team there is Chinese. We<br />

are now working on enabling our<br />

colleagues there to carry out all of<br />

their tech nical, support and sales<br />

tasks more<br />

independently than before.”<br />

THE HIGH “MADE IN SAXONY-<br />

ANHALT” QUALITY is also popular<br />

in the USA, where the durability<br />

of the machinery as well as their<br />

efficiency, precision and reliability<br />

are all valued. The good customer<br />

references says Mössner, not<br />

without a little pride, have helped<br />

the company to develop its sales<br />

activities in additional markets in<br />

Asia and South America.<br />

Even though Mössner will always<br />

feel loyal to his home town of<br />

Munich, he strongly recommends<br />

Saxony-Anhalt to every entrepreneur:<br />

“Those with an idea are taken<br />

seriously – and supported.” Just<br />

one email to the Otto von Guericke<br />

University Magdeburg proved<br />

enough: students and engineers<br />

are now carrying out research<br />

with engineers from Laempe<br />

& Mössner into an approach for<br />

the virtual simulation of mixing<br />

processes.<br />

www.laempe.com<br />

FACTS<br />

DIPL.-ING. Hans-Joachim Laempe<br />

founded his company in the Black<br />

Forest in the year 1980. In 1995,<br />

he built a 15,000 qm factory<br />

workshop which is home to the<br />

construction of core machines for<br />

foundries. It is also the home of<br />

the administrative offices.<br />

THE COMPANY'S ANNUAL<br />

TURNOVER is 65 million Euros,<br />

and the business has 300 employees.<br />

Laempe & Mössner now<br />

has some 20,000 supported systems<br />

worldwide and customers<br />

throughout Europe, and also<br />

in China, the USA, India, Brazil,<br />

Mexico and Australia.

FRICTION<br />

WELDING<br />

PROCESSES 4.0<br />

Rotational friction welding is a highly productive<br />

process for connecting an exceptional variety of<br />

components together. A sophisticated process with<br />

s everal influencing factors.<br />

THE DEVELOPMENT of new components<br />

for the automotive industry<br />

for example, starting from the<br />

drawing board and through to the<br />

prototypes, has traditionally been<br />

a complicated and high-cost task.<br />

With a software package for process<br />

simulation which has been<br />

developed at the Otto von Guericke<br />

University Magdeburg (OvGU),<br />

scientists, engineers and business<br />

owners from Saxony-Anhalt want<br />

to optimise the process of friction<br />

welding.<br />

“If one of my best scientific staff<br />

approaches me with a good idea,<br />

I feel I have no choice but to put<br />

it to use,” emphasizes Professor<br />

Dr. Ing. Jens Strackeljan, Rector of<br />

the OvGU Magdeburg, discussing<br />

his motivation for supporting the<br />

project. The Professor is talking<br />

about David Schmicker, who chose<br />

to complete his dissertation on<br />

the topic of “A holistic approach on<br />

the simulation of Rotary Friction<br />

Welding.” His goal is to develop a<br />

simulation software which can depict<br />

the friction welding processes<br />

at the highest level of precision. It<br />

is an innovation which would also<br />

result in a clear improvement for<br />

industrial businesses.<br />

Comparing simulations and<br />

reality for rotational friction<br />

welding.<br />

Sophisticated and high-cost<br />

development processes could<br />

therefore be shaped so that they<br />

are considerably more effective<br />

from both the temporal and<br />

financial perspectives. Gerald<br />

Langer, the Managing Director of<br />

IFA Technologies GmbH, has also<br />

recognised the potential: “In the<br />

area of manufacturing, optimised<br />

processes are of decisive importance<br />

for the market viability.” In<br />

the future, the European market<br />

leader for drive shafts wants to<br />

focus more strongly on the areas<br />

of innovation and system expertise.<br />

With the motto of “GO IFA”,<br />

achieving a stronger differentiation<br />

from the competition is being<br />

pursued, with the ambitious<br />

goal of achieving further better-than-average<br />

rates of growth<br />

over the coming years. “That's<br />

a good enough reason to participate<br />

in this project and help<br />

shape the transfer from theory to<br />

practice,” says Langer.<br />

The project clearly demonstrates<br />

THE EFFECTIVE and close networking<br />

between the worlds of<br />

science and business in Saxony<br />

Anhalt. The necessary research<br />

was completed in the course of<br />

the scientific work at the OvGU in<br />

Magdeburg, and the virtual RFW<br />

software was created. The success<br />

story stands out due to its short<br />

distances, the close collaboration<br />

between the research institutes<br />

and the world of industry, and the<br />

concerted action to strengthen<br />

the locations in Saxony-Anhalt.<br />

THE POWER OF<br />

MEASUREMENTS<br />

Everyone should try and save electricity. That’s something<br />

that's been known for a long time. As a result of the energy<br />

transition and the continuously increasing rates of competition,<br />

companies are only compatible with the future if they<br />

align their processes on an energy-efficient basis.<br />

FINDING THE RIGHT TECHNIQUES<br />

HERE and tracking down the ener<br />

gy guzzlers is far from easy. The<br />

staff from the ER-WIN® innovation<br />

cluster at the Fraunhofer Institute<br />

for Factory Operation and Automation<br />

IFF in Magdeburg went on<br />

search for them at the company<br />

MTU Reman Technologies GmbH<br />

Magdeburg, and were able to<br />

present some astonishing results.<br />

“We approach things differently<br />

than conventional energy consultants,”<br />

explains Dipl.-Wirt.-Ing.<br />

Marc Kujath of ER-WIN®. “On the<br />

basis of a comprehensive approach,<br />

we are able to depict the resource<br />

consumption of entire value added<br />

chains or even individual components.”<br />

In the analysis phase, each<br />

individual machine was verified<br />

and the energy consumption was<br />

mea sured. What is more exciting,<br />

how ever, is the monitoring of the<br />

entire production process, all the<br />

way through to the differentiation<br />

of the components. In this respect,<br />

reconditioning a crank-case at the<br />

individual positions will lead to a<br />

different level of energy consumption<br />

than the reconditioning of a<br />

cylinder head.<br />

For MTU Reman Technologies<br />

GmbH, which develops processes<br />

ER-WIN® identifies “energy guzzlers”:<br />

machines from MTU Reman<br />

Technologies GmbH put to the test<br />

and procedures for the reconditioning<br />

of diesel and gas-powered<br />

engines, this approach has<br />

yielded new knowledge. “Before<br />

this project, we were focusing<br />

on completely different areas of<br />

production as the biggest guzzlers<br />

of energy,” reports Martin<br />

Altrock, Manager of Servicing<br />

and Energy at the company MTU<br />

Reman Technologies GmbH. The<br />

measuring systems that were<br />

already used were only capable<br />

of displaying some point-specific<br />

potential energy savings. By depicting<br />

the energy consumption<br />

for the entire value added chain,<br />

it is now possible to better assess<br />

and manage the sequence of<br />

processes.<br />

In this example, THE CLOSE NET-<br />

WORKING between the worlds<br />

of science and business isn’t only<br />

to be found at the factual level in<br />

this example. The short paths between<br />

the research institutions,<br />

educational colleges and businesses<br />

in Saxony-Anhalt are a clear<br />

advantage for strengthening the<br />

locations in the federal state.<br />

One of the key focal points of the<br />

research work of ER-WIN® is on<br />

achieving a clear practical orientation<br />

and economic feasibility. “It’s<br />

no use to develop attractive visions<br />

which nobody is ultimately<br />

able to afford,” explains Kujath. In<br />

the case of the project with MTU<br />

Reman Technologies GmbH, one<br />

of the results of the collaboration<br />

was that it provided the basis<br />

for the company's certification<br />

according to DIN ISO 500<strong>01</strong>.<br />

“GREEN HYDROGEN” WHICH IS MADE FROM THE WIND AND THE SUN AND IS STORED IN<br />

CAVERNS, POWERS E-CARS AND FINDS USE AS A BASE MATERIAL IN THE CHEMICALS INDUSTRY.<br />

SUCH ARE THE IDEAS OF “HYPOS” | www.hypos-eastgermany.de<br />

These days, those who require hydrogen obtain it from natural gas. Thanks to HYPOS, however, this<br />

dependency has become a thing of the past. With 45 million Euros of funding from the German<br />

federal government, by 2<strong>01</strong>9, a demonstration facility at the Fraunhofer Institute at the chemicals<br />

location of Leuna is to show how hydrogen can be made from alternative energy sources on a large<br />

scale and economical basis. In this way, it should be possible to store green energy independently<br />

of the weather conditions and transport it to the major chemical parks in central Germany via the<br />

existing pipelines.<br />

Initially conceived as a technology platform<br />

for the miniaturisation of industrial products<br />

in Saxony-Anhalt, TEPROSA GmbH is<br />

now a dynamic technology company.<br />

TEPROSA is taking on a key position between the<br />

worlds of science and industry with fine-tuned<br />

and high-precision techniques for the development<br />

and processing of micro-structures. Its<br />

range of services encompasses laser- and microprocessing,<br />

electro-technical developments as<br />

well as damage and component analyses.<br />

For the high-tech start-up, which was spun off<br />

from Otto von Guericke University Magdeburg in<br />

2009, the area of miniaturisation has proven to<br />

have big potential. In this respect, high-precision<br />

laser cutting is the supreme discipline. “Smaller,<br />

finer, better” is the company motto and vision,<br />

all-in-one. | www.teprosa.de<br />

Harnessing hydropower: sustainable and<br />

ecological, decentralised, without the need for<br />

major construction work and even in the places<br />

where there’s only a limited flow velocity – this<br />

is the task that Entertainer Energy GmbH has<br />

set itself. A joint project with future potential.<br />

The “Enertainer” and the “River Rider” are the first<br />

developments of the company Enertainer Energy<br />

GmbH, which was founded in 2<strong>01</strong>1 by five entrepreneurs<br />

from Central Germany. Steel constructors,<br />

control engineers, installation technicans and planners<br />

are combining their strengths to turn the idea<br />

of decentralised hydropower plants into production<br />

maturity. The goal is to make energy generation by<br />

means of hydropower environmentally-friendly and<br />

to open up new fields of business for the individual<br />

partner companies in an important market of the<br />

future. | www.enertainer-energy.de<br />

PM TEC Rolls & Covers from Merseburg plans,<br />

designs, manufactures and coats precision<br />

rolls. Together with the University of Applied<br />

Sciences Magdeburg-Stendal, a process for the<br />

production of high-gloss mirror surfaces on<br />

large rolls has now been developed.<br />

To manufacture the precision surfaces of its large<br />

rolls, PM TEC required its own technology platform<br />

for the purpose of polishing and finishing. In just 18<br />

months, a process-safe procedure was developed;<br />

the result of a close, exceptionally well-coordinated<br />

collaboration with the “Innovative Manufacturing<br />

Processes” industrial laboratory at the university. The<br />

researchers have the proof that finishing is usable<br />

as a key technology in a variety of industrial sectors.<br />

Due to the innovative process, PM TEC remains the<br />

market leader. | www.pmtec-rc.de<br />

The story of the company Gollmann Kommissioniersysteme<br />

GmbH might have been written<br />

in an entrepreneur’s handbook: in just a short<br />

time, a company that “began life in a garage”<br />

has become a respected medium-sized systems<br />

manufacturer. And with its fully automated<br />

shutter cabinet systems for pharmacies, the<br />

Halle-based company has achieved a number<br />

one hit.<br />

JUST 60 SQUARE METRES in the back room of a<br />

neighbourly systems manufacturer, but plenty<br />

of space for ideas – that was the situation when<br />

Dipl.-Ing. Daniel Gollmann founded the company<br />

“Gollmann Kommissioniersysteme GmbH” in 2005<br />

with his Swiss business partner Ivan Zwick in Halle.<br />

Just ten years later, the systems manufacturer delivers<br />

its machines to 13 countries, including Austria<br />

and Switzerland, but also Australia, Italy and Spain.<br />

That the idea got off the ground in the first place<br />

was actually a coincidence and down to a friend of<br />

Gollmann. This friend was working at a pharmacy<br />

where she wanted to automate her medical storage<br />

system. Yet the conventional automated systems<br />

were either too big, too heavy or too expensive.<br />

Daniel Gollmann came up with the solution: why<br />

not use shutter cabinets like those in a library? He<br />

developed a compact model made of lightweight<br />

aluminium with a gripper arm. The same year, the<br />

first automated storage systems were sold – and the<br />

company moved from that back room to the historic<br />

coffee factory buildings in Halle. These days, more<br />

than 100 people work at the headquarters alone.<br />

Daniel Gollmann has always believed in his ideas and<br />

he is open to the knowledge of others. He not only<br />

gathered a team of highly qualified professionals, including<br />

from the fields of research and development,<br />

design, production and sales for his company, he<br />

also brought creative minds on board. The company<br />

a&m creative services is a specialist in 3D visualisation<br />

and makes things visible that are otherwise<br />

hard to describe. "We wanted to show potential<br />

customers what we can do," recalls Daniel Gollmann.<br />

An ideal connection. Both business partners think<br />

outside the box, are prepared to take risks, and develop<br />

targeted solutions. "We knew immediately that<br />

we would be able to benefit from each other," says<br />

Karsten Angermann, one of a&m’s two directors.<br />

A SIGNIFICANT COMPETENCY ADVANTAGE: The<br />

team at a&m creative services draws on several years<br />

of experience – as a manufacturer of CG image and<br />

film material for customers in the automotive and<br />

industrial goods sectors. Its technical thinking in combination<br />

with its creative approach benefits both of<br />

its partner companies. The systems manufacturer<br />

has a clear competitive advantage in the areas of both<br />

marketing and communication. With their powers<br />

of presentation, the creative experts are setting new<br />

standards in the B2B pharmacy market.<br />

390,000 new malware per day present the<br />

developers of anti-virus software with considerable<br />

challenges. AV-Test GmbH puts the<br />

reliability and constancy of these programs<br />

to the test. The Magdeburg-based developers<br />

check anti-virus programs in real time worldwide.<br />

They are specialists in the fight against<br />

computer viruses.<br />

IN A late-nineteen-century villa in Magdeburg's old<br />

town, the world's most important IT security products<br />

are put through their paces. Over two million files<br />

are checked here per day with 30 virus scanners. A<br />

data processing centre, test laboratory and development<br />

environment all in one – that's AV-TEST GmbH.<br />

Founded in 2004 by Magdeburg residents Andreas<br />

Marx, Guido Habicht and Oliver Marx, today some<br />

30 employees work at the Magdeburg company<br />

that’s dedicated to superior IT security.<br />

THE DEMAND for a sophisticated test process for<br />

IT security products was recognised early on by<br />

Andreas Marx, a business information specialist and<br />

native citizen of Magdeburg. Due to the rapidly increasing<br />

levels of internet crime in recent decades,<br />

in the office buildings of today, having effective<br />

data security has become as important as having<br />

an alarm system. With our permanent testing<br />

process, we provide manufacturers with real data<br />

for the continuous improvement of their systems,"<br />

emphasizes Marx, highlighting the innovative way<br />

in which AV-TEST works.<br />

INTERNATIONALITY and worldwide business relationships<br />

are included with all of the products and<br />

services. Germany is only home to a few manufacturers<br />

of anti-virus programs. Yet AV-TEST didn’t<br />

choose to set up in Magdeburg simply because<br />

Andreas Marx wanted to stay in his home town.<br />

“The university, with its Faculty of Computer Science<br />

and Working Group for Multimedia & Security, is<br />

on our doorstep, and is exceptionally important for<br />

both our student projects, but also for our search<br />

for employees,” explains Marx. “Low living costs<br />

and a high quality of life also make Magdeburg a<br />

great place in which to work.”<br />

Designer Mona Mijthab and the German Society for International Cooperation<br />

(GIZ) have set themselves the task of improving the catastrophic sanitation<br />

situation in the poverty-stricken, densely populated urban areas of developing<br />

countries. For this purpose, a "mobile sanitation unit" has been developed – a<br />

small, lightweight sit-down toilet which works without electricity or water. The<br />

excrement is used recycled into raw materials such as biogas, compost fertiliser<br />

and fire briquettes, which benefit the population. Designer Mona Mijthab of<br />

Saxony-Anhalt was presented the BESTFORM AWARD 2<strong>01</strong>3 for her innovation. |<br />

As the federal state’s central funding agency,<br />

the Investment Bank Saxony-Anhalt<br />

(IB) realises the promotion of economic<br />

development on a targeted basis and<br />

supports companies in an advisory capacity. It pays<br />

close attention to the promotion of research and<br />

development as well as innovation. One example of<br />

this is the INNOVATION ASSISTANT, which has been<br />

on offer since 1994.<br />

The IB has been accepting new applications for the<br />

INNOVATION ASSISTANT since the end of February.<br />

What is behind this programme?<br />

RENO PAUL: Saxony-Anhalt is home to many small<br />

and medium-sized enterprises (SMEs). The INNOVA-<br />

TION ASSISTANT intends to bring highly qualified<br />

university<br />

graduates into companies. This allows the latest<br />

know-how to be transferred directly into the economy.<br />

How is this implemented?<br />

MANUELA SACHER: When someone joins a business<br />

fresh from the university, they usually only have<br />

limited work experience, but their specialist knowledge<br />

is cutting edge. For a company, this presents<br />

both opportunities and risks. The funding we provide<br />

enables companies to afford specialist staff and<br />

makes it easier for graduates to start their careers. For<br />

example, in 2<strong>01</strong>3, with the help of the INNOVATION<br />

ASSISTANT, the company Leukhardt Schaltanlagen<br />

Systemtechnik GmbH from Magdeburg hired a highly<br />

qualified specialist for electrical engineering. The<br />

knowledge that the specialist provided enabled the<br />

company to access new services and product segments<br />

and to achieve an improved market position.<br />

For whom is the funding available?<br />

RENO PAUL: All commercial SMEs with permanent<br />

operations in Saxony-Anhalt which hire a graduate<br />

for a newly created position here in the federal state.<br />

For example, for a project in research/development,<br />

product development or product design. The graduate<br />

must have a degree in engineering, natural<br />

sciences, economics or the creative sector.<br />

MANUELA SACHER: Very important: the employment<br />

relationship must not already exist at the time<br />

of application.<br />

How high is the available subsidy?<br />

RENO PAUL: For a maximum of two innovation assistants,<br />

up to 50 percent of the staff costs are subsidised<br />

for a two-year period. For each full-time job, this<br />

amounts to a maximum of 30,000 Euros per year.<br />

What do you recommend to applicants?<br />

RENO PAUL: Arrange an appointment with the<br />

Investment Bank. We can then provide you with<br />

initial feedback as to whether any possible funding<br />

is available for the project.<br />

WINNER OF THE HUGO JUNKERS PRIZE:<br />

P-D AIRCRAFT INTERIOR GMBH<br />

Exceptionally stable and comparatively lightweight – components like floor<br />

panels and side panels in aeroplane cabins are made from specialist fibrereinforced<br />

plastics which have to fulfil the highest quality and safety requirements.<br />

The production of these materials is extremely energy-intensive,<br />

however. At least until now. The aviation supply company P-D Aircraft Interior<br />

GmbH from Bitterfeld-Wolfen, winner of the Hugo Junkers Prize 2<strong>01</strong>4 for resource<br />

efficiency, has developed chemical formulations and processes which<br />

enable energy savings of up to 35 percent. | www.pd-ai.com
